Today for some reason I am feeling unusually happy. Almost too happy for me. I am on about 3.5 weeks of taking Celexa. Could this be the meds kicking in or is something else.

It could definitely be the meds kicking in. When I start a med (I start and stop a lot), I feel really good after about a week, then it levels off and then near the month mark I definitely feel like I am much more content with everything.

They say it takes about 6 weeks to reach therapeutic levels, but I'm sure everyone is different.

I'm on Wellbutrin (have been for a number of years) but I remember it feeling like that in the beginning. I really started to feel almost too good in the beginning. But it settled out after a few weeks and now it just helps to keep me level and from sinking too low.

OW was right also, different people can react quite differently. But 3.5 weeks doesnt' sound too early to me for you to feel a difference.

Although it may be that a "normal" level of happiness may feel really intense if its been a long time. Big Grin
